West Midtown Atlanta,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in West Midtown Atlanta?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Midtown Atlanta 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,365 | $797 | $8,500 |
West Midtown Atlanta 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,950 | $1,465 | $10,000+ |
| West Midtown Atlanta 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,635 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| West Midtown Atlanta 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,242 | $750 | $7,500 |
| West Midtown Atlanta 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,104 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about West Midtown Atlanta
What type of rentals are currently available in West Midtown Atlanta?
There are currently 322 Apartments for Rent in West Midtown Atlanta, GA with pricing that ranges from $503 to $24,728. There are also 345 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in West Midtown Atlanta ranging from $425 to $24,999.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in West Midtown Atlanta?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in West Midtown Atlanta ranges from $425 to $24,999 with an average monthly rent of $2,793.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in West Midtown Atlanta?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in West Midtown Atlanta range from $965 to $24,728,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,465 to $12,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,500 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$832.
